Transaction 28ff7233206db944215a7e57e97a758d7cc4e9d03656b0ccc62da2822e4a1091

1 Input
2 Outputs
  • 28ff7233206db944215a7e57e97a758d7cc4e9d03656b0ccc62da2822e4a1091:0
  • value  66275102
    address  1MxmS2FbVGXhCLvwZhY6SeyQk1vmboc2HZ
  • 28ff7233206db944215a7e57e97a758d7cc4e9d03656b0ccc62da2822e4a1091:1
  • value  1371605350
    address  1CHZyPVVkY2KjJzCH8Znx6GucQYFDrt4yt